if(type==4){
}//这里的type==4的有多个,怎么将它存储到数组里面

解决方案 »

  1.   

    if(type==4){
     var arr=new Array();
     arr[0]="type1";
     arr[1]="type2";
     arr[2]="type3";
     arr[3]="type4";
    }
      

  2.   

    if(nodes[root].type==4){//nodes[root].type是一个类型
    如果这个类型==4就将root存到数组里面}
      

  3.   

    有很多的话用个for循环存进去
      

  4.   


    var arr = [];
    if(nodes[root].type==4){//nodes[root].type是一个类型
    arr.push(root);
    }
    alert(arr);     //自己输出试试不清楚楼主意思,想要这样么?
      

  5.   

    你把问题说清楚啊,你的type==4这个type是从哪里来的??或者你把上下的关联代码都贴出来